Beautiful Losers Nike dunks

I’ve been meaning to write a entry about the current political advertising war tentatively entitled “Battling for Definition.” I’m going to hold off on that though as Beautiful Losers opens tomorrow, and instead point you to Supertouch, where they unveiled a sampling of the 22

Beautiful Losers dunks that Nike specifically created in conjunction with the film.  Each shoe is emblazened with stills from the film - something that as far as I am aware has never been done before.  They will be auctioned off for charity through the course of the film’s theatrical run.

If you want to check out a few of the shoes in person they will be on display at the www.IFCcenter.com starting tomorrow.
